Transaction 524421fb3bafdf8258fd683ff66a66ea8d7ce51f5b0125c52c8d5eff0c513b86

1 Input
2 Outputs
  • 524421fb3bafdf8258fd683ff66a66ea8d7ce51f5b0125c52c8d5eff0c513b86:0
  • value  19877120
    address  3HvDHyFYNgDUdXvNoV7ty5GJir945ieaAr
  • 524421fb3bafdf8258fd683ff66a66ea8d7ce51f5b0125c52c8d5eff0c513b86:1
  • value  102056365
    address  1NyJoLCk4NUohCFvxBRJKLhEce2jEUopgQ